Product Overview
HYTOPTODEVICE 25G-SFP28-BXU-I is a high-reliability industrial-grade 25G BiDi SFP28 transceiver fully compatible with Brocade network devices. Complying with SFP28 MSA and IEEE 25GBASE-BR10 industry standards, it delivers stable 25.78Gbps high-speed transmission up to 10km over G.652/G.657 single-mode fiber. Adopting 1270nm-TX/1330nm-RX single-fiber simplex LC design, this BiDi module requires paired reverse-wavelength modules for bidirectional communication. DDM/DOM supported.
This module supports steady operation across -40℃ to 85℃, adapting to extreme outdoor and industrial harsh environments.perfectly suited for industrial network renovation, telecom fronthaul and edge data center interconnection.
Pre-programmed with exclusive Brocade-adapted EEPROM firmware, our 25G-SFP28-BXU-I module achieves true plug-and-play operation with zero system alarms on all mainstream Brocade switches and routers. Usage Guidelines & Best Practices

1. Exclusive Single-Mode Fiber (SMF) & Wavelength Pairing

  • Exclusive SMF Compatibility: Designed strictly for OS2 Single-Mode Fiber (SMF) with Simplex LC(UPC)  connectors. Multi-mode fiber (MMF) is not compatible and will cause high insertion loss or complete link failure.

  • Mandatory Tx/Rx Wavelength Pairing: BiDi technology transmits and receives over a single fiber strand using two distinct wavelengths. Modules must be deployed in complementary pairs:

2. Hot-Swapping & Mechanical Care

  • Hot-Pluggable Support: Fully supports hot-swapping—can be safely inserted or removed while host equipment (switches/routers) is powered on without interrupting non-related port traffic.

  • Latch Mechanism: Always unlock and use the integrated bail latch to remove the transceiver. Never pull directly on the fiber cable or the body of the optical module to prevent internal optical alignment damage.

  • ESD Precautions: Practice strict Electrostatic Discharge (ESD) measures (e.g., grounding wrist straps) during field installation to protect sensitive high-speed ICs.

3. Industrial-Grade Thermal Management

  • Wide Operating Temperature Range: Rated for harsh industrial environments from -40°C to +85°C (-40°F to 185°F).

  • Enclosure Airflow: Ensure industrial enclosures or outdoor cabinets provide sufficient airflow or heat dissipation to keep the module’s real-time internal temperature within operating limits.

4. Fiber Hygiene & Optical Protection

  • Cleanliness Standard: Inspect and clean all LC fiber end-faces with a 1.25mm fiber cleaning pen or lint-free wipes before insertion. Microscopic dust is the leading cause of high attenuation and port degradation.

  • Dust Protection: Always re-install dust caps on transceiver optical ports and fiber patch cables whenever they are disconnected.

  • Short-Distance Safeguard (<2km): For short-reach testing in labs, check Digital Optical Monitoring (DOM) receiver power. Use an inline optical attenuator if incoming power exceeds the maximum RX overload threshold to prevent photodiode damage.

5. Switch Configuration & Real-Time Monitoring

  • Port Speed & FEC Matching: Ensure the host port speed is manually set to 25G. Verify that RS-FEC (IEEE 802.3 Reed-Solomon Forward Error Correction) is enabled consistently on both endpoints, as 25G BiDi links typically require FEC for error-free performance.

  • DOM Diagnostics: Leverage real-time Digital Optical Monitoring (DOM/DDM) via your switch OS to track critical operating parameters:

    • Tx/Rx Optical Power levels

    • Module Operating Temperature

    • Laser Bias Current & Supply Voltage

The Core Features

1. Optimize Fiber Resources with Single-Fiber BiDi Architecture

Our BiDi design integrates transmit and receive channels onto one fiber strand, cutting fiber consumption by half compared with traditional duplex modules. It eases fiber shortage pressure on industrial and telecom sites and significantly reduces cabling, termination and civil engineering costs during network expansion.

Single-fiber BiDi SFP28 cuts fiber expenditure for Brocade industrial network bulk orders


2.
Expand Network Capacity Without New Fiber Runs

Running short of available fiber strands? This transceiver separates upstream and downstream signals on distinct wavelengths over a single fiber. You instantly lift network throughput without deploying new fiber routes, delivering remarkable cost advantages for brownfield network renovation and 5G fronthaul build-outs.


25G BiDi transceiver boosts network capacity without laying extra fiber cables for Brocade deployments


3.
High-Density 25G Ethernet for Modern Network Upgrades

Compact SFP28 form factor paired with low power consumption enables seamless migration to 25G high-speed Ethernet. It maximizes port utilization on Brocade switches, saves rack space and power overhead, serving as a practical choice for edge data centers and industrial network transformation.

FAQ

Q1: What internal laser and receiver components are integrated in 25G BiDi 10km transceivers?
A1: Our Brocade compatible 25G-SFP28-BXU-I industrial transceiver adopts an uncooled DFB distributed feedback laser matched with a high-sensitivity PIN photodiode receiver. This mature hardware combination delivers low power consumption and cost-efficient performance, perfectly meeting standard 10km single-mode fiber transmission requirements for Brocade industrial network deployments.

Q2: Can 25G BiDi 10km modules support transmission distances over 10km such as 12km or 15km?
A2: Extended-distance operation beyond 10km is conditional and not standardized. The module features a 6.3dB fixed power budget; stable links are only achievable when total link loss from fiber, splices and connectors stays below this threshold. Exceeding 10km will break IEEE standard dispersion and power margin limits, easily causing packet loss and unstable Brocade network links.

Q3: Are 25G BiDi 10km SFP28 modules compatible with traditional 10G SFP+ switch ports?
A3: Standard single-rate 25G-only 25G-SFP28-BXU-I modules cannot sync with 10G SFP+ ports. Only dual-rate 10G/25G BiDi variants support cross-speed operation, and users must manually force the host Brocade port to 10G speed for normal link activation.

Q4: Do high-density switch deployments require extra cooling for 25G BiDi 10km industrial modules?
A4: No additional dedicated cooling is needed. Our Brocade-compatible 25G BiDi modules feature ultra-low power consumption around 1.2W, far lower than high-power 100G/400G optical transceivers. Maintaining standard rack airflow is sufficient to guarantee long-term stable operation in high-density Brocade switch environments.

Q5: What is the leading cause of CRC errors and frame loss on 25G BiDi 10km fiber links?
A5: Contaminated or scratched LC fiber end-faces are the primary trigger of abnormal CRC and frame errors on Brocade 25G BiDi links. Tiny dust, oil stains or surface scratches will interfere with single-fiber bidirectional optical signal transmission, resulting in data frame distortion and continuous error reports.

Q6: How much insertion loss does a standard Simplex LC patch cord adapter introduce?
A6: A fully cleaned and qualified simplex LC-LC adapter brings 0.2dB to 0.5dB standard insertion loss. For Brocade 25G BiDi 10km networking projects, multiple adapter stacking will accumulate link loss, so reasonable cabling design is required to avoid exceeding the module’s power budget.

Q7: What is the standard MTBF lifespan of industrial 25G BiDi 10km transceivers?
A7: Our 25G-SFP28-BXU-I Brocade compatible industrial modules deliver exceptional reliability with an average MTBF of over 1.5 million hours under standard operating conditions, ensuring ultra-long stable service life and low failure rate for global bulk deployment and industrial networking projects.

Q8: Is the 25G BiDi 10km transceiver compliant with CPRI Option 10 wireless link standards?
A8: Yes. CPRI Option 10 runs at a 24.33Gbps transmission rate, which is fully compatible with the 25.78Gbps wire speed of our Brocade 25G-SFP28-BXU-I industrial modules. It supports seamless adaptation to 5G wireless fronthaul CPRI Option 10 link deployment scenarios.

Q9: What does rising laser bias current in DDM monitoring indicate for 25G BiDi modules?
A9: Persistently climbing laser bias current (gradually approaching 30–40mA) captured by DDM/DOM monitoring is a clear sign of internal laser diode aging. This symptom predicts imminent module performance degradation and link failure, reminding users to replace aged modules in advance for Brocade network maintenance.

Q10: Do 25G BiDi 10km SFP28 transceivers integrate built-in CDR circuits?
A10: All our Brocade-compatible 25G-SFP28-BXU-I industrial transceivers are equipped with dual host-side and line-side CDR clock data recovery circuits. The built-in CDR effectively filters high-frequency signal jitter, optimizing signal integrity and maintaining ultra-stable transmission quality for 25G high-speed fiber links.
